A flour manufacturer founded in 1940 in Sakurai City, Nara Prefecture. In addition to manufacturing approximately 200 types of wheat flour, the company provides OEM manufacturing of premix flour for bread, noodles, confectionery, and batter applications. Small-lot production from 200kg is available, with flexible accommodation of diverse formulations including materials with strong colors and aromas. Operating as a "Flour Products General Consultation Office," the company supports original product development that addresses customer challenges.
A major OEM manufacturer of health foods and pharmaceuticals headquartered in Gifu City, Gifu Prefecture. Founded in 1907, the company began as a beekeeping business. With 1,641 employees and revenue exceeding ¥36.6 billion, it provides one-stop OEM services from raw-material processing through ingredient development. Holds proprietary technologies in freeze-drying, fermentation, and natural-extract concentration. Strong in development and manufacturing of foods with functional claims (kinōsei hyōji shokuhin). Operates four factories: Motosu, Ikeda, Ibigawa, and Next Stage.

A pickled plum manufacturer headquartered in Minabe Town, Wakayama Prefecture. Founded in 1948, the company boasts over 70 years of expertise in plum products. Located in the birthplace of Nanko plums, it uses plums from a production area certified as a UNESCO World Agricultural Heritage Site. As a major pickled plum manufacturer with approximately 121 employees, the company supplies commercial-grade pickled plums and provides OEM manufacturing services. The company obtained SQF certification in 2020.
A food manufacturer headquartered in Shinagawa Ward, Tokyo. A 100-year company founded in 1912. Engaged in the manufacturing and sales of margarine, mayonnaise, and dressing products. Operates a JAS-certified mayonnaise factory in Shiga. Offers multiple types of mayonnaise including whole egg type and egg yolk type. Supplies a wide range of products from school lunches to commercial food service. Operates three factories: Kasukabe Factory (Saitama), Shiga Factory, and Bihoro Factory (Hokkaido).
A halal food manufacturer headquartered in Nakano Ward, Tokyo. Established in 1985, Japan's first specialized Turkish import trading company. Since 2016, it has manufactured frozen prepared dishes, confectionery and bread, and bento boxes at one of Japan's few fully halal-certified factories. The company also accepts contract manufacturing in small lots, which major factories cannot accommodate. Its strength lies in the development of unique halal food products utilizing Turkish culinary expertise.
A frozen Japanese confectionery manufacturer headquartered in Kurate County, Fukuoka Prefecture. A group company of Warabeya Nichiyou Holdings (listed on Tokyo Stock Exchange Prime). Boasts manufacturing experience of approximately 500 product types and handles OEM and private brand contract manufacturing for both commercial and retail frozen Japanese confectionery. Main products include daifuku (55% composition), warabi mochi (20%), kuzu mochi (15%), and sakura mochi (10%). Equipped with individual packaging capability, statutory labeling compliance, prototype development services, and rapid freezing equipment.
A health food OEM/ODM manufacturer with headquarters in Chiyoda Ward, Tokyo and the Harima Production Development Center in Tatsuno City, Hyogo Prefecture. The company handles both raw material sales and contract manufacturing, possessing proprietary functional ingredients including hyaluronic acid and Acanthopanax senticosus extract. The company provides support for filing documents for foods with functional claims and conducts SR (Systematic Review) research. It accommodates all dosage forms including powders, granules, tablets, capsules, drinks, and jellies.
A leading soy milk manufacturer in Japan headquartered in Okazaki, Aichi Prefecture. With miso and soy milk as core business segments, the company began manufacturing soy milk beverages in the early 1980s. Leveraging aseptic filling technology developed through soy milk production, the company provides OEM manufacturing services for various beverage products. The company operates large-scale production facilities across multiple locations including Tottori Factory and Toyama Factory. The company has a track record of developing Soymilk Yogurt (plant-based lactic acid fermented products).

An established noodle manufacturing company with a history spanning over 100 years, founded in Meiji 41 (1908). While inheriting the traditional hand-pulled noodle production methods of Shimabara soumen, the company also operates a mechanized noodle manufacturing facility. It manufactures a wide range of products including hand-pulled soumen, semi-dried noodles, dried noodles, and frozen hand-pulled noodles. OEM production is available with a minimum order of 10 cases.
Established in 1973 as the food division of the Shikoku Kakoki Group. Committed to quality soybeans, nigari, and water, with over half a century of tofu-making expertise. Leverages the group's cutting-edge tofu manufacturing machinery and aseptic filling technology, operating from two production sites in Tokushima and Shizuoka. Offers an integrated product development system from planning to manufacturing.
A condiment and beverage manufacturer based in Shizuoka Prefecture, established in 1978. JAS-certified mayonnaise producer offering PB and OEM contract manufacturing. Operates three dedicated mayonnaise production lines at the Shizuoka factory with an annual capacity of 10,000 tons. Flexible production from small to large lot sizes.

Founded in 1920, a printer supply manufacturer with over 100 years of history. Houses an Edible Ink Lab at its headquarters, researching and developing food printing technology for confectionery, foods, and tablets. Offers contract printing services on edible sheets, with a minimum lot of 1,000 sheets. Extensive production experience in novelty items and collaboration cafe products.
A long-established food manufacturer with approximately 190 years of history, founded in 1837 (Tempo 8). The company manufactures and wholesales konjac, tokoroten (jelly noodles), and nikki kanten (cinnamon agar). While evolving traditional foods to suit modern tastes, the company also focuses on quality improvement, such as using plant-derived ingredients for coloring. Products have been presented at the Ise Grand Shrine Geku Dedication Market.
